Mitsubishi Raider DuroCross V8

The Mitsubishi Raider is a mid-size pickup truck featured in the fall of 2005 as a 2006 model for the American market. Developed by DaimlerChrysler, the Raider is based on the Dodge Dakota. Unfortunately, it is not available in Canada. This pickup truck bridges the gap that opened up since the discontinuation of the Mitsubishi Mighty Max in 1996. To power the Raider, drivers can choose between a 4.7 L PowerTech V8 engine that outputs 230 hp and 290 ft.lbf and a 3.7 L PowerTech V6 engine putting out 210 hp. The moniker itself was recycled from the Dodge Raider SUV sold from 1987 to 1990, a rebranded Mitsubishi Montero. However, the Raider hasn't managed to take hold within the market as sales have been extremely poor since its debut. In January and February 2006, only 377 and 492 respectively were sold compared to the Dakota's 4,583 and 6,260 in sales. Reports suggest that Mitsubishi dealers have an overabundance of Raiders on hand. Mitsubishi asked DaimlerChrysler to lower production and it has been recorded that 9,861 Raiders were built in 2005 with only 297 more being constructed from the start of 2006 till March 11.
